Owned for less than 1 week when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.I was quite skeptical about this as it had a lot of reviews on bestbuy complaining about the ease of use and connectivity issues. I followed the instructions and was able to set this up in under 5 mins. I have tried about 4 soundbars in different price range before buying this one e.g. Sonos beam + sub + surrounds (which I had owned for about 2years), JBL 9.1 (5.1.4 actually), LG SN9YG to name a few. I loved the beam as a stand alone soundbar but there is diminishing value in adding sub and the surrounds (specially the surrounds). LG would be slightly better in terms of the whole experience but I found that the vocals were not that good and I couldn't hear them properly in some movies. JBL 9.1 is an extremely good buy for the price but I ended up returning it for other reasons (not that i wasn't satisfied). I did experience a few drop outs but nothing major. That being said I'm glad that I returned it and tried Samsung Q950T as its just amazing. I'm no expert but I can tell you as an avid music listener and a movie buff that I really enjoy this system. Dialogues are clear, surround sound experience is better than what I have experienced (I have never owned a home theater so Im comparing it to the soundbars I've used) and so far I have not experienced any connectivity issues (fingers crossed). I will strongly recommend this to anyone looking for a good soundbar (surround system) and is okay spending 1400$ but if you are on a budget JBL 9.1 is also a solid soundbar for the price. |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Pros: - Setting up the sound bar was very simple and straight forward. I have read some reviewers reporting connection issues but provided some guidance in the order which the satellites and sub were to be connected. I followed the manuals instructions (for HDMI ARC connection) and was up and running in no time. - The first thing I noticed when first firing up the sound bar (Avengers End Game) was how much more immersive the soundstage was compared to the MS750. The previous soundbar got the job done, but it was just good clear sound. I never experience Atmos before and with my 9' ceiling I did look up a few times to see where the sound was coming from. The Atmos effects are quite good for a package that was smaller than the MS750. The rear channels and the sub are also far superior to the the addon units to the MS750. Sometimes I had to put my ear to the rears to see if they were putting anything out. Where as the Q950T I know for sure things are happening behind me. I am not an audiophile, but the impresses me. - Smaller bar over the previous sound bar. Cons: - The biggest con by far is the LED display placement. The only time a top display would b seen as beneficial is at the store looking down from the TV you are standing right in front of. What engineer or product designer thought this was a good idea? Everytime I want to change a setting/mode I have to get up and walk right in front of a 65" TV to look at the TINY display (if they put the display on top, WHY is it SO SMALL!? - I do not like the fabric that the bar and the rear surrounds are wrapped in. They are lint/dust magnets that need a lint brush or roller to clean. Again design team, I question why home theater electronics need to be upholstered. - The rear surrounds are a good deal larger than the rears of the add on set of the MS750, taking up more space than I'd like on the console table behind my couch. Will have to invest in speaker stands. - Roughly 20% of the time the soundbar does not turn on with the TV. This seems to be an inherit problem with ALL Samsung bars I have used in the past. Is this really THAT difficult to get right? - Alexa integration is not really necessary for my use case as I have a Fire TV Cube connected to my TV so it is redundant. - The SmartThings control is super basic with virtually no meaningful settings. It's not worth the hassle to open the app to control the volume. Also given the fact that the miniscule display is not visible while sitting on your couch, it would have been a major selling point to allow full control/customization via your phone. Seems like a huge missed opportunity. SmartThings should be the ultimate central control hub for TVs and all peripherals related. - No room calibration options? Seems like this is becoming a common feature for all the major players. Every room is different. To have a flagship soundbar not able to be optimized to the room it's situated in is doesn't do the product any favors. This Samsung HW-Q950T has replaced the mid tier HW-MS750 soundbar with the additional surround speakers and sub. And the sound I am able to get from this unit is impressive and satisfying. Unfortunately I could not not test eARC or Q-Symphony as my older Samsung Q9 does not support these features. As I mentioned I am not an audiophile by any stretch of the imagination but at the full MSRP of $1700 I can't say that I would fully recommend this product at that price. The price point will undoubtedly fluctuate to make it a better buy. Updates to firmware and SmartThings integration would make the soundbar much better but given Samsungs track history for supporting electronics beyond their shelf life cycle I'm not holding my breath, especially with a new flagship Q bar on the horizon that they will be focused on pushing. My conclusion is while this soundbar is far superior to my previous setup and it is more than satisfactory for me, BUT Do Not Buy at at full retail.

Your issue may be caused by wireless interference. When there is a wireless device (e.g., wireless LAN) using the same frequency (5.8GHz) near the Soundbar, the wireless connection between the Subwoofer and Surround Speaker could become unstable. This will affect the quality of audio output.
In this case, the radio frequency channel of the Subwoofer and Surround Speaker can be changed as below :
1. With the power of the Soundbar on, vertically press and hold the WOOFER button on the remote controller for at least 5 seconds.
• The display shows “W-CH” and the currently set radio frequency channel.
2. Press the Up/Down button on the remote controller to change the radio frequency channel, and then press the Play button.
• The display shows “OK” and then the frequency is set to the changed channel.
• You can exit the setting mode by pressing any button other than Up/Down or Play.
The maximum transmission distance of the main unit’s wireless signal is about 32.8 ft. but may vary depending on your operating environment. If a steel-concrete or metallic wall is between the main unit and the wireless subwoofer, the system may not operate at all because the wireless signal cannot penetrate metal.
For optimal listening performance, make sure that the area around the wireless subwoofer and the Wireless Receiver Module is clear of any obstructions.
To maximize bass from the soundbar and subwoofer, there are two adjustments that can be made:
1) Using the WOOFER button on the remote, you can adjust the volume of the subwoofer between -6 to +6 by toggling the button up or down. To set the subwoofer volume level to 0, press the button in.
2) Adjust the bass control by pressing the SOUND CONTROL button (gear icon) on the remote control, then select BASS to increase the level. You can adjust the volume between -6 to +6 by using the Up/Down buttons.
For precise audio adjustments, you can use the 7-band frequency equalizer to optimize the sound for your room acoustics.
